Output 64c0b1571392ccd190c8c91c9cab2502767e7c7ba1e146bad1feb5e722f4235a:3

value
28467563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52bed93f978eb7c14abd98e9374163cd9ffbabb OP_EQUAL
address
MTLJnTrGDu1bUWd98xBiYVeYwazs2ZxENC
transaction
64c0b1571392ccd190c8c91c9cab2502767e7c7ba1e146bad1feb5e722f4235a
spent
true